This three bedroom semi-detached family home should be at the top of your viewing list. Spread over two floors, on the ground floor is a lounge/diner, kitchen and WC. On the first floor are three bedrooms and bathroom. Further benefits include double glazing & gas central heating. To the outside are front & rear gardens, with summer house and access to the garage at the rear.
The rear has some lovely hillside views and distant castle views.

The property is situated in the popular Elms Vale area of town and only a short distance from the town centre. Dover main-line railway station with the fast link train to St Pancras in just over an hour is within walking distance. Within the area, there is a good range of primary and secondary schools, together with the Dover Boys' Grammar School. Elms Vale recreation ground and Whinless Down trust land perfect for young families and dog walkers close by. There are good access routes to the A20/M20. With St James's development close by with a cinema complex, a range of restaurants and High Street shops including Next and Marks & Spencer
